Yoshi's New Switch 2 Game Is Getting A Demo On The Nintendo eShop

A free demo for the Nintendo Switch 2 game Yoshi's Encyclopedia of Mysterious Creatures is now available on the Nintendo eShop.

The brief

Recent coverage from outlets including GAMINGbible and Saiga NAK details the release of a free demo for a new Nintendo Switch 2 title. Specifically, the game is titled Yoshi's Encyclopedia of Mysterious Creatures, and its demo has been made available on the Nintendo eShop. According to the available reports, users can investigate three distinct types of mysterious creatures within this newly released software sample. This promotional drop represents a notable early look at upcoming software for the hardware platform.

Reporting on this development focuses heavily on the accessibility of the trial version. GAMINGbible frames the release as a free Switch 2 taster provided by Nintendo for its own AAA title, while Saiga NAK emphasizes the specific gameplay feature allowing players to investigate three distinct types of mysterious creatures.
